Re: [CMS-PIPELINES] SPECS IF ... comparing strings

2018-12-17 Thread Michael Harding
Easy, use a specs variable:
...
'|Specs a: w -1 . . if a=="stuff" then ... else ... endif

The last I knew, double-quotes were the only acceptable delineator for this
construct but that may have changed.
